Output 10671b24489a8db493d84b6f7ce4d4675ef6afa87b35121aa185b2e04df9cc25:3

value
36549565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c0a8fdce1e917e687880f2f3c933959d2c4161 OP_EQUAL
address
3KidqbRf11DHxzYf5UbW6LoLfePEe4fj2z
transaction
10671b24489a8db493d84b6f7ce4d4675ef6afa87b35121aa185b2e04df9cc25
spent
true